Verb [Ido]

IPA: /savuˈrar/
Etymology: Borrowed from English savor, French savourer.   1. (transitive) to savor, relish (a dish) Tags: transitive

  2. (transitive, figuratively) to enjoy, delight in Tags: figuratively, transitive

Verb [Romansch]

Etymology: From Latin sapor (“taste, flavour”), from sapiō, sapere (“taste of, have a flavour of”), from Proto-Indo-European *sap- (“to try, to research”).   1. (Rumantsch Grischun, Sutsilvan, Vallader, followed by da) to smell (of) Tags: Rumantsch-Grischun, Sutsilvan, Vallander Synonyms: ferdar da [Sursilvan], suarar [Surmiran], savurer [Puter]
